    Contributor's Note:  Recently, legendary singer/songwriter Chris De Burgh released his 27th studio album entitled "The Legend of Robin Hood."  The album takes on his story and conceptualizes the injustices, circumstances and the life that Robin Hood lived and brings it to life for the listener.  The album was so well put together that a production company out of Germany is going to make it into a musical.


    "The Legend of Robin Hood" was produced by Chris Porter and it takes the listener through an aural extravaganza through a wide variety of musical genres including Medieval, traditional, nursery rhymes, Celtic, folk, rock, classical and choral.  The album includes the single "Live Life, Live Well" along with a reimagination of one of de Burgh's crowd favorites entitled "Light a Fire."

    Contributor's Note:  Scottie Brown talks to THE MYLES KENNEDY on the Scholastic Perspectives Podcast(formerly known as Madness To Creation) about "Ides of March", which was released awhile back via Napalm Records.  Scottie and Myles talks about mental health and the nuances behind the creative process of "Ides of March" and Myles was absolutely vulnerable in talking about mental health through the pandemic and life balance.  "The Ides of March" reached numerous Billboard chart positions including #1 in Current Hard Music in the United States, #1 Official Rock & Metal Albums in the United Kingdom, #1 Official Independent Album Chart in the U.K. and #1 Hard Music Album in Canada.  The album includes "In Stride" and the pensive ballad "Love Rain Down."  Myles puts in incredible solo work along with life changing material in Alter Bridge and has also fronted in Slash's band for numerous shows.  Myles could be most famously known for WWE Superstar Edge's entrance music for "Metalingus."  Fans can find Myles Kennedy on Facebook, his official website and Instagram.

    Editor's Note:  Mike Score of legendary 80's New Wave band A FLOCK OF SEAGULLS joined the Madness To Creation Podcast for the second season and 34th episode to talk about their latest offering entitled "String Theory."  This record is a reimagination of their classics and fan favorites including "Say You Love Me", "Space Age Love Song", "The More You Live, The More You Love", and their iconic classic "I Ran(So Far Away)", which fans have heard all over from The Wedding Singer to Pulp Fiction to the Grand Theft Auto Vice City video game.  With "String Theory", fans will get to hear orchestral opuses and reimaginations, which makes it a beautiful offering by A Flock Of Seagulls.  A Flock Of Seagulls will be touring at the following stops:
